Turkey: Lavrov and Cavusoglu condemn Trump’s decision on Golan Heights


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ov and his Turkish counterpart Mevlut Cavusoglu met in Antalya on Friday, commenting on the US decision to recognize Israeli sovereignty over the Golan Heights.

According to Lavrov, “this is a conscious demonstration of permissiveness. Such a demonstration of permissiveness along with threats, ultimatums, and sanctions are, in general, all the tools used by the United States on the foreign policy arena.”

The Turkish FM stated that “after Trump signed this document, five minutes later we made our first statement and expressed our reaction. We categorically do not accept this decision as it is contrary to international law and UN resolutions. These territories belong to Syria.”
